Pros & cons summary


Recency 26 November 2015 24 August 2022
Maximum RAM amount 4 GB 6 GB
Chip lithography 28 nm 6 nm

Data Center GPU Flex 140 has an age advantage of 6 years, a 50% higher maximum VRAM amount, and a 367% more advanced lithography process.

We couldn't decide between GeForce GTX 960 OEM and Data Center GPU Flex 140. We've got no test results to judge.

Be aware that GeForce GTX 960 OEM is a desktop graphics card while Data Center GPU Flex 140 is a workstation one.
